Matrix requires valid certificates for federation with other servers from
version 1.0 onward. If the FreedomBox server already has LE cert and private
key, copy them into /etc/matrix-synapse
- Add certificate renewal hooks for Matrix Synapse. Reusing the certificate
renewal mechanism built for ejabberd with matrix-synapse as well. One notable
difference is that Matrix Synapse doesn't support switching the domain name or
dropping the Let's Encrypt certificate.
- Use self-signed certificate if there is no LE certificate. Matrix Synapse
server startup fails if the files homeserver.tls.crt and homeserver.tls.key
are missing.
- Copy Apache's snakeoil certificates to /etc/matrix-synapse when LE
certificates are not available. Prefer LE certificates if available.
- Display warning if no valid LE certificate is found.

/etc/matrix-synapse/homeserver.yaml file has several complex cases of inline
comments which are introducing bugs when parsed with ruamel.yaml
Eliminated the problem by discarding comments altogether since the YAML data is
only read by Plinth and not by a human.

- Created basic plinth app which starts an introducer and a storage
node on the FreedomBox.
- Prompt user to set a domain name before creating Tahoe-LAFS nodes.
- Support adding and removing of introducers to the storage node.
- Serve Tahoe-LAFS from a different port.
- Start all nodes and introducers at system startup.
